Hello all, I sighted in my PC Carbine with a red dot at the range the other day, I really enjoy shooting this gun, nice trigger pull and reset, pretty accurate up to 100 yards. At this point the only complaint I have is, it's a dirty gun. The blow back action makes a mess, so I strip it down after each range session. While reassembling and installing the bolt carrier group the recoil spring and buffer need a little compression to slide into the receiver, I've done this many times in the past. The assembly was hanging up a bit and when I let go of it the plastic recoil spring retainer clip let go and the clip and spring went flying. I recovered the parts, the hole in the plastic buffer plate is ruffed out. This is a poor design, I trimmed the ruff edges and reassembled. The clip doesn't have much to set into, this is going to happen again. Anyone have this problem with their PC carbine?? I'll be calling Ruger for replacement parts.

"it's a dirty gun. The blow back action makes a mess, so I strip it down after each range session."
Taking care of your firearm is commendable BUT as with many similar comments concerning the MK and 22/45 pistols, there can be such a thing as overdoing the cleaning. Some designs aren't really intended to be subjected to constant (and unnecessary) dis/reassembly.
I shoot 22/45 pistols with a suppressor(undoubtedly the dirtiest combination other than black powder) but constant cleaning of the unsightly but not function inhibiting residue is unwarranted.
